Web23 Feb 2024 · To get the average accounts receivable for XYZ Inc. for that year, we add the beginning and ending accounts receivable amounts and divide them by two: $2,500 + $1,500 / 2 = $2,000. To calculate the accounts receivable turnover ratio, we then divide net sales ($60,000) by average accounts receivable ($2,000): $60,000 / $2,000 = 30.

WebDefinition of Fees Earned. Fees earned is defined as the revenue that a company earns from the services it provides to its clients. It is also known as service revenue, and it is recorded as an income in the company’s financial statements.
